सामग्री पर जाएं

Android SDK क्विक स्टार्ट

इस त्वरित और सरल उदाहरण का उपयोग करके Pushwoosh Android SDK के साथ आरंभ करें।

पूर्वापेक्षाएँ

Anchor link to

अपने ऐप में Pushwoosh Android SDK को एकीकृत करने के लिए, आपको निम्नलिखित की आवश्यकता होगी:

उदाहरण प्रोजेक्ट डाउनलोड करें

Anchor link to

GitHub से उदाहरण प्रोजेक्ट क्लोन करें:

Terminal window
git clone https://github.com/Pushwoosh/pushwoosh-android-sample

प्रोजेक्ट को कॉन्फ़िगर करें

Anchor link to
  1. अपनी google-services.json फ़ाइल को pushwoosh-demoapp/app डायरेक्टरी में रखें।

  2. अपनी build.gradle (मॉड्यूल: ऐप) में, अपने पैकेज नाम से मेल खाने के लिए applicationId को अपडेट करें।

  3. res/values/strings.xml में, प्लेसहोल्डर मानों को अपने विशिष्ट विवरणों से बदलें:

  • pushwoosh_app_id: अपने Pushwoosh ऐप कोड का उपयोग करें।
  • fcm_sender_id: अपने Firebase प्रोजेक्ट नंबर का उपयोग करें।
  • pushwoosh_api_token: अपने Pushwoosh डिवाइस API टोकन का उपयोग करें।
strings.xml
<resources>
<string name="app_name">demoapp</string>
<string name="title_home">एक्शन</string>
<string name="title_notifications">सेटिंग्स</string>
<string name="pushwoosh_app_id">_YOUR_PUSHWOOSH_APP_ID_</string>
<string name="fcm_sender_id">_YOUR_FIREBASE_PROJECT_ID_</string>
<string name="pushwoosh_api_token">_YOUR_PUSHWOOSH_DEVICE_API_TOKEN_</string>
</resources>

प्रोजेक्ट चलाएँ

Anchor link to
  1. प्रोजेक्ट को बिल्ड और रन करें।
  2. ऐप में दो टैब होंगे: “एक्शन” और “सेटिंग्स”। सेटिंग्स टैब पर जाएँ।
  3. पुश के लिए रजिस्टर करें बटन पर टैप करें।
  4. पुश नोटिफिकेशन के लिए अनुमति दें। डिवाइस Pushwoosh के साथ पंजीकृत हो जाएगा।

आपको इस तरह की एक लॉग एंट्री देखनी चाहिए:

Logcat
Log level: INFO
[RequestPermissionHelper] Requesting permissions
Pushwoosh SDK initialized successfully
HWID: __HWID_OF_YOUR_DEVICE__
APP_CODE: __YOUR_PUSHWOOSH_APP_ID__
PUSHWOOSH_SDK_VERSION: __PUSHWOOSH_SDK_VERSION_INSTALLED__
FIREBASE_PROJECT_ID: __YOUR_FIREBASE_PROJECT_ID__
PUSH_TOKEN:
User ID "__USER_ID_OF_THE_DEVICE__" successfully set
[NotificationManager] Registered for push notifications: __DEVICE_PUSH_TOKEN__

एक पुश नोटिफिकेशन भेजें

Anchor link to

Pushwoosh कंट्रोल पैनल पर वापस जाएँ और अपने पंजीकृत डिवाइस पर एक पुश नोटिफिकेशन भेजें

आगे क्या है

Anchor link to

अधिक जानने के लिए, कृपया बुनियादी एकीकरण गाइड देखें।